I am an expert witness for sports, leisure, and facility safety, including swimming pools, water parks, outdoor watersports, drowning detection systems, accident investigation, in-water play equipment, lifeguarding, and training requirements.
I have eight years of experience as an expert witness for aquatic safety issues in over 30 cases throughout the UK, Guernsey, Spain, Latvia, Turkey, Bulgaria, Hong Kong, and the Caribbean.
I am a commercial leisure advisor to the RLSS UK and a past director of the International Life Saving Federation of Europe. I was a Member of the ISO SW/136/8 technical committee and the liaison for EN 1069-1 and -2, which produced a range of leisure and water safety standards, including those on swimming pool safety, waterslide safety, wave machine safety, watersport safety (e.g. surfing, jet skis, paddleboarding etc.), floating play equipment, inflatable play equipment, open water safety, beach safety and Automated Monitoring and Detection Systems.
I was Head of Product Strategy and a Management Systems Tutor at the British Standards Institute, where I developed a deep knowledge of British, European and International Standards. I have previously worked as a Head of Health and Safety and National Lifeguarding Manager for a multi-site leisure operator. I also run the Water Incident Research Hub, a resource supporting managers to run safe aquatic venues.
I have extensively authored several guidance notes and training courses related to my expertise, including the recently revised RLSS UK National Pool Management Qualification, Operator Guidance for the Safe Operation of Open Water Venues, and Guidance for managing Non-Lifeguarded Pools and Sessions.
